This evaluation will concentrate on proof for the application of the first 3 approaches when spaces are inhabited. Of these methods, upper-room UVGI has been made use of for more than 70 years to minimize transmission of pathogens such as tuberculosis (TB). The researches in this review cover different UVGI modern technologies that can be utilized in areas with individuals present, including UV-C lights that are wall-mounted, UV-C ceiling followers, and portable UV-C air cleaners.
9 researches were included, nine coverage on the performance (See Evidence Table 1-3) and two reporting on the security (Table 4) of UVGI modern technologies to reduce SARS-CoV-2 in the air of busy areas. The proof was from simulation (n=8) and observational (n=1) studies and general the degree of proof in this testimonial is considered low.
Both the wall surface placed and ceiling follower components have disinfecting UV-C lights that intend up at the ceiling. These modern technologies worked in decreasing SARS-CoV-2 in the air of occupied spaces in both empirical (n=1) and simulation (n=6) researches. A Russian hospital reported only community acquired COVID-19 cases among staff April to June 2020 and no transmission amongst people to team in health center spaces with wall-mounted top area UVGI components (low-pressure mercury lights, 254 nm).

This included an area investigation and a simulation research. High level factors are listed here and information on individual research studies can be discovered in Table 4. An area investigation from Russia reported that top room UVGI low-pressure mercury lights (254 nm, 30 W) made use of 24 hr a day, 7 days a week, in busy healthcare facility rooms were risk-free.
The greater the UVGI lamp is situated on the wall Visit Website surface, the lower the danger of over-exposure. If the ceiling height is 2.74 m, a UVGI light installing elevation of 2.29 m results in a minimized level of UV-C radiation showed right into the lower zone of the area, compared to an installing elevation of 2.13 m.
When both UVGI lights were located on one long wall surface of the area, it resulted in the cheapest risk of overexposure. D'Alessandro (2021) Simulation study Italy Mar 2021 An EulerianLagrangian design was created to examine the impact of UV-C irradiation on inactivation of air-borne virus/bacteria particles in a cloud of saliva droplets. Clouds generated from one, 2, and three cough ejections were designed.
In the version, the radiation dosage enough to suspend SARS-CoV-2 was utilized as the "vulnerability continuous" for the virus/bacteria (8.5281 x 10-2 m2/J). UV-C irradiation was shown to efficiently inactivate the majority of SARS-CoV-2 particles in a cloud of saliva beads after 4 secs. The UV-C light with a power of 55 W was much more efficient at inactivating SARS-CoV-2 over a duration of 10 secs contrasted to 25 W.
